Matteo Montani's Vanishing Painting at Galleria Nicola Pedana

exhibition · 2026-05-05

Matteo Montani (Rome, 1972) presents a solo exhibition at Galleria Nicola Pedana in Caserta, featuring a vanishing painting technique. The show includes a large wall drawing that transforms the space into a pulsating organism, along with studies and a disappearing sculpture. An installation is also on view in the upper vestibule of the Reggia di Caserta.
